Get your dog to return when called
Recall training is crucial for both dogs and their owners for many reasons and our fun and easy to follow recall training class will give joy back to your walks.
Safety:
A reliable recall is essential for keeping dogs safe in various situations. Dogs who come when called can be kept out of dangerous situations such as running into traffic or encountering aggressive animals. Without a reliable recall, dogs may put themselves at risk of injury or harm.
Freedom and Enjoyment:
Dogs with a strong recall have more freedom to explore off-leash environments, such as parks or hiking trails, while remaining under their owner’s control. This allows them to fulfil their natural instincts to roam and explore while providing owners with peace of mind.
Bonding and Trust:
Training a reliable recall strengthens the bond between dogs and their owners. When dogs learn to respond promptly to their owner’s call, it demonstrates trust and respect for their leadership. This positive reinforcement strengthens the bond and enhances the relationship between the dog and their owner.
Preventing Behavioural Issues:
Dogs who lack a reliable recall may engage in undesirable behaviours such as wandering off, chasing wildlife, or ignoring commands. By training a strong recall, owners can prevent these behavioural issues from developing and reinforce positive behaviours instead.
Emergency Situations:
In emergency situations, such as a dog approaching another aggressive dog or encountering a potential hazard, a reliable recall can be lifesaving. Being able to call a dog back quickly and effectively can prevent conflicts or dangerous situations from escalating.
Compliance with Lead By-laws:
In areas where lead by-laws apply, having a dog with a reliable recall allows owners to enjoy off-leash activities legally and responsibly. This promotes positive interactions with other dog owners and ensures compliance with local regulations.
Peace of Mind:
Knowing that their dog will come back when called gives owners peace of mind, whether they are enjoying outdoor adventures or simply letting their dog play in a fenced yard. This confidence in their dog’s behaviour enhances the overall quality of life for both the dog and their owner.
In summary, recall training is essential for the safety, freedom, and well-being of both dogs and their owners. By investing time and effort into training a reliable recall, owners can enjoy a closer bond with their dog, greater peace of mind, and more enjoyable experiences together.
Stop your dog pulling on its lead
Lead training, or leash training, is crucial for both dogs and their owners for several reasons:
Safety:
Proper lead training helps ensure the safety of both the dog and the owner during walks. Dogs who pull excessively on the lead can be difficult to control, leading to potential accidents or injuries. With effective lead training, dogs learn to walk calmly beside their owner, reducing the risk of incidents such as pulling into traffic or tripping their owner.
Control and Management:
The leash training programme gives owners greater control over their dog’s movements, allowing them to guide and direct the dog as needed. This is particularly important in busy or crowded areas where distractions abound. By teaching the dog to walk politely on the lead, owners can manage their dog’s behaviour and prevent unwanted interactions with other dogs, people, or wildlife.
Improved Bonding and Communication:
Learning to walk nicely with your dog provides opportunities for bonding and communication between the dog and their owner. Through consistent training and reinforcement, dogs learn to understand and respond to cues from their owner, strengthening the bond between them. Clear communication on the lead fosters trust and cooperation, enhancing the overall relationship.
Behavioural Benefits:
Lead training helps address and prevent a variety of behavioural issues commonly associated with walking on a lead, such as pulling, lunging, or excessive excitement. By teaching the dog to walk calmly and attentively on the lead, owners can instill good leash manners, and promote positive behaviour during walks.
Exercise and Enrichment:
Regular walks are essential for a dog’s physical and mental well-being, providing opportunities for exercise, exploration, and stimulation. Effective lead training ensures that walks are enjoyable and beneficial for both the dog and the owner, allowing them to reap the rewards of outdoor activity together.
Community Engagement:
Well-behaved dogs who walk nicely on the lead contribute to positive interactions and perceptions of dogs in public spaces. By demonstrating good leash manners, owners promote responsible dog ownership and consideration for others, fostering a more harmonious community environment.
Overall, lead training is essential for the safety, well-being, and enjoyment of both dogs and their owners. By investing time and effort into training proper lead manners, owners can ensure that walks are pleasant, safe, and enriching experiences for their dog and themselves.
